Maintenance I/E Technician – 1904122 – Sparks, GA

 

BASF's Crop Protection Site in Sparks, Georgia is seeking an Maintenance I/E Technician who has the skills necessary to install, maintain, and troubleshoot site instrumentation, control systems, and electrical equipment in order to provide safe operation with maximum production availability. The candidate will report to and receive work assignments, priorities, etc from the Maintenance Supervisor.

 

Responsibilities include but are not limited to the following:

·  Complete required repairs and tasks to instruments, controls, and electrical systems in an efficient, timely manner in order to restore or maintain safe operating capability.
·  Install and verify new instrument, control and electrical systems according to vendor specifications and maintenance procedures using drawings, manuals, or blueprints.
·  Recommend changes to existing instruments, controls, electrical systems or equipment in order to improve reliability, accuracy, or further optimize processes.
·  Recommend tools, equipment or methods to improve the safety and timeliness of system repairs.
·  Communicate any alterations to existing instrument, control, or electrical systems to ensure all site records are current and proper documentation is completed.
·  Maintain acceptable housekeeping standards in the work area
·  Ability to safely operate forklifts and manlifts
·  Detailed knowledge of operations, maintenance, repair, and calibration of chemical process instrumentation and controls (for level, flow, pressure, temperature and analysis.)
·  Knowledge of electronic process control systems, including programmable logic control (PLC) systems and the ability to troubleshoot and maintain these systems.  
·  Knowledge of electrical supply and distribution systems (motors, motor control center (MCC), transformers, lighting, wiring, etc.).
·  Ability to read and troubleshoot electrical control schematics.
·  Knowledge of safety regulations associated with a chemical operation
·  Knowledge of safety practices and techniques relating to industrial manufacturing (LOTO, Confined Space Entry, Hot Work, Line Break)
·  Ability to effectively handle multiple tasks simultaneously
·  Ability to work a flexible schedule and respond to call-ins and impromptu overtime on nights and weekends
·  Strong leadership and team skills
·  Excellent problem solving and communications skills

Ingredients for Success: What We Look for in You…

Basic Qualifications:

·  High School Diploma or GED and 3 years of I/E Maintenance experience or a Two-year technical degree in an I/E Maintenance field.
Preferred Qualifications:
·  3 years of PLC experience
·  Experience with calibrating and configuring Instrumentation using HART based communicators.
·  Knowledge of the NEC code. An understanding of working in electrically classified areas
·  Ability to write and revise written job instructions.
·  Working Knowledge of computers, MS Windows operating system, and email (i.e Word, Excel, Internet Explorer, Lotus Notes)
